I teach middle school musical theatre. For many of my students, this is an introduction to theatre, their first experience on stage. Our semester long project involves the completion of a model theatre. It is usually made from a shoe box. The theatre includes seating, the stage, lighting, curtains, and backdrop. We continue this project by reading an one act play. Choosing one scene from the play, students design costumes and make up for characters. They also design the scenery and lights.
